Your attorney should be answering these questions for you. Or rather, you should be asking your attorney these questions. If you will be testifying in Court then your attorney will proabably prepare you before you testify. At least, thats what a competent attorney will do. Otherwise, other ppl might be testifying, like your ex. etc. You won't testify unless your attorney thinks that you should. So discuss these things with your attorney. That what you pay him for, among other things, like hopefully winning the case.
